I am interested in corresponding with other XTP users and/or 
implementors. If you have had experience in either of these areas 
I would very much appreciate hearing from you. The only other
group using/implementing XTP that I am currently familiar with are
the Computer Networks Lab at the University of Virginia, Charlottesville, 
and a company named Protocol Engines Inc. who are developing a hardware
implementation (protocol engine) that supports XTP.

XTP is an acronym for the Xpress Transfer Protocol.

There is a mailing list, "xtp-relay@pei.com" ("pei" == Protocol Engines, Inc.),
for discussing XTP and its implementations. To have your address added to
the list, send email to "xtp-request@pei.com". There are currently about 100
participants. (Note: The list has been very quiet lately...)

To get a copy of the latest spec (XTP version 3.5) and/or more XTP or PEI
info, send a *surface mail* address to "xtp-request@pei.com". [The spec is
not currently email-able.)
